Assistant Swim Coach
GENERAL FUNCTION
Under the direction of the Competitive Swimming Director assists with the coaching responsibilities of daily practices for the Developmental and Age Group level squads. This includes maintaining a high level of communication with fellow coaches, assisting with daily practices, attending swim meets (Friday evenings and weekends), and assisting with the planning of events (competitive and social). The Assistant Age Group Coach should be able to answer questions pertaining to the Age Group and Developmental levels of the swim team and should be knowledgeable of the other areas of the YMCA.
Know-how
Previous competitive coaching experience/participation is strongly recommended. Certifications in the following safety areas: CPR for the Professional Rescuer, Lifeguard Training or Safety Training for the Swim Coach, and First Aid, which we will recertify yearly. Other certifications: YMCA Principles of Competitive Swimming and Diving and USA Swimming Foundations of Coaching. The successful candidate must pass both the YMCA background screening as well the USA Swimming background screening and attend a new hire orientation before they will be able to begin work.
PRINCIPAL ACTIVITIES
Create and execute curriculum and seasonal plan for pre-team program in cooperation with Competitive Swimming Director.
Report to the Competitive Swimming Director on matters relating to the team. (i.e. behavioral issues, team development, etc.)
Assist with other age group level squad practices if needed.
Attend all scheduled meets assigned by the Competitive Swimming Director.
Keep all required certifications up to date (CPR, Coaches Safety Training, First Aid).
Continue personal education related to the sport of swimming.
Perform other duties as designated by the supervisor.
Job Description may be changed at any time by supervisor.
PHYSICAL DEMANDS
Sufficient strength, agility, and mobility to perform essential functions of the position, and to supervise program activities
While performing the duties of this job, this individual may occasionally be exposed to outdoor weather conditions, wet and/or humid environments, moderate/ extreme noise
EFFECT ON END RESULT
Assist in organizing, promoting, and developing an efficient and effective swim team program to encourage enjoyable youth participation and retention.
